KNDY Area High School Football Scores – Week 9 (Playoffs) – 10/27/2023

NORTH CENTRAL KANSAS LEAGUE
Abilene 38, Arkansas City 13
Clay Center 55, Clearwater 10
Hesston 20, Marysville 17
Rock Creek 54, Chapman 18
Wamego 58, El Dorado 14
Wichita Collegiate 49, Concordia 7

TWIN VALLEY LEAGUE 8-MAN
Axtell 58, Wakefield 0 (Thursday)
Clifton-Clyde 84, Hill City 78 (Thursday)
Doniphan West 43, Marais des Cygnes Valley 42
Frankfort 60, St. John’s/Tipton 0 (Thursday)
Hanover 54, Lakeside 8 (Thursday)
Linn 92, Pike Valley 48 (Thursday) (Non-Playoff)
Osborne 56, Blue Valley 6 (Thursday)
Washington County 50, Stockton 18 (Thursday) (Non-Playoff)

TWIN VALLEY LEAGUE 11-MAN
Centralia 50, Oskaloosa 14 (Thursday)
Jeff County North 48, Troy 22
Valley Falls at Onaga
Valley Heights 58, Whitewater Remington 14 (Thursday)

Derek Nester was born and raised in Blue Rapids and graduated from Valley Heights High School in 2000. He attended Cowley College in Arkansas City and Johnson County Community College in Overland Park studying Journalism & Media Communications. In 2002 Derek joined Taylor Communications, Inc. in Salina, Kansas working in digital media for 550 AM KFRM and 100.9 FM KCLY. Following that stop, he joined Dierking Communications, Inc. stations KNDY AM & FM as a board operator and fill-in sports play-by-play announcer. Starting in 2005 Derek joined the Kansas City Chiefs Radio Network as a Studio Coordinator at 101 The Fox in Kansas City, a role he would serve for 15 years culminating in the Super Bowl LIV Championship game broadcast. In 2020 he moved to Audacy, formerly known as Entercom Communications, Inc. and 106.5 The Wolf and 610 Sports Radio, the new flagship stations of the Kansas City Chiefs Radio Network, the largest radio network in the NFL. Through all of this, Derek continues to serve as the Digital Media Director for Sunflower State Radio, the digital and social media operations of Dierking Communications, Inc. and the 6 radio stations it owns and operates across Kansas.
